How To Choose The Best Chocolate Gifts
The right chocolate gift hinges on three factors: the recipient’s taste in cocoa intensity, the occasion’s formality level, and the visual impact of the packaging. A heavy dark-chocolate set impresses a connoisseur but falls flat for a milk-chocolate traditionalist.
Dark vs. Milk vs. White Ratio
Check the product description for the split between dark, milk, and white chocolates. A balanced assortment typically leans 50/50 on dark and milk, with white as an accent. All-dark boxes appeal to a smaller audience and work best when you know the recipient prefers single-origin or high-cacao varieties.
Packaging That Stays
A reusable tin or magnetic gift box adds perceived value far beyond the chocolate inside. Recipients keep the container, which extends the memory of the gift. Thin cardboard boxes with cellophane windows often feel disposable and suggest a lower-tier offering.
Freshness Indicators
Individually wrapped pieces preserve freshness and make sharing sanitary. Look for shrink-wrapped internal trays or sealed inner bags. A gift basket that lists “chocolate-covered pretzels” alongside “chocolate clusters” signals a variety of textures that keeps the eating experience interesting.

Cocoa & Packaging Guide
Chocolate Type Matters
Dark chocolate contains higher cacao solids and less sugar, making it ideal for adults who appreciate bitter notes. Milk chocolate includes milk powder for creaminess and appeals to a broader audience. White chocolate is cocoa butter based without cocoa solids and works as a sweet accent. A quality gift box should specify the cacao percentage or at least the chocolate origin (e.g., Belgian, Swiss) rather than using vague “chocolatey coating” language.
Freshness Seals
Individually wrapped pieces or shrink-wrapped inner trays lock in moisture and prevent bloom—the white discoloration that occurs when cocoa butter separates from cocoa solids. Bulk unwrapped chocolates in a basket are more vulnerable to temperature fluctuation during shipping. For corporate or long-distance gifting, individual wrapping is the safer bet for arrival quality.
